Sarah Slöström & Vladimir Morozov – Winner of the #SWC18 | FINA Swimming World Cup 2018
Congratulation to Sarah Sjöström and Vladimir Morozov – the champions of the FINA Swimming World Cup™ 2018. Sjöström defended her title ahead of her hardest competitor Katinka Hosszu with a total of 339 points, and Vladimir Morozov repeated his success from 2016 with a total of 402 points.

FINA Swimming World Cup – Singapore | #SWC18
The 2018 FINA Swimming World Cup came to an end in Singapore. Once again, the crowd was treated to some splendid racing. The two overall winners were also crowned: Sarah Sjöström, who defended her title from the previous year and Vladimir Morozov, repeating his success from 2016.

Color-Changing Swim Trunks Transform With Heat
Tom van Dieren is the 20-year-old creator of SEA’SONS swimwear, a line of color-changing swim trunks. He had the idea to create a swim short that could change with water temperature. SEA’SONS swim shorts are treated with heat-sensitive microcapsules that change when you’re in the pool or ocean or when you’re out in the sun…
